What to Expect on the Jupiter Island Water Tour

This cruise lasts about 1 hour and 30 minutes, giving you a relaxed window to enjoy the water and the views without feeling rushed. Departing from Castaways Marina at Square Grouper Tiki Bar, the tour offers a gentle ride through the calm Atlantic Intracoastal Waterway. The boat is small enough to keep things intimate—a maximum of 24 travelers—so it feels personal, yet spacious enough to enjoy the surroundings comfortably.
The itinerary revolves around two main highlights: the stunning views of Jupiter Island’s estate homes and an overview of the local area. The tour features a stop where you can gaze at some of the most impressive properties in the region, including the homes of high-profile celebrities like Tiger Woods, Olivia Newton-John, Greg Norman, and Alan Jackson.

FAQs about the Jupiter Island Water Tour

How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es, providing enough time to relax and enjoy the scenery without feeling rushed.
Where does the tour start and end?
It departs from 1111 Love St, Jupiter, FL, at Castaways Marina at Square Grouper Tiki Bar, and returns to the same location.
What’s included in the ticket price?
You’ll get light snacks, water, and sodas at no extra charge, making it easy to stay refreshed during the cruise.
Can I bring my own drinks or snacks?
Yes, the tour encourages bringing your favorite snacks or beverages, including wine or other adult drinks, if you prefer.
